Coaching & Consulting Content Strategy on TikTok
Coaching and consulting content on social media follows a clear hierarchy: authority-building content dramatically outperforms generic motivational clips. The coaches and consultants generating real client inquiries from short-form video share a pattern — they lead with a specific, contrarian insight that challenges conventional thinking, then deliver a framework or method the viewer can immediately test. This "free value" approach paradoxically drives more business than direct promotion because it proves competence before asking for trust. The ideas below are structured around the authority-building formats working in the coaching vertical: client result stories, myth-busting content, framework reveals, and "what I would do differently" retrospectives.
TikTok rewards raw authenticity and fast pacing over polished production. The algorithm favors strong hooks and high completion rates, which means front-loading value and maintaining energy throughout the video is more important than perfect lighting or transitions. Sound-on content with trending audio performs significantly better than sound-off text overlays on this platform.
Content Ideas
"The advice I give my $10K clients (free)"
Angle
Generosity flex — giving away premium advice builds trust
Shot Concept
Direct to camera → actionable advice → implementation steps → results preview
Why It Works
Viewers think "if the free content is this good, what does the paid version look like?"
"My client went from $5K to $50K months — here's the exact shift"
Angle
Client result with specific mechanism
Shot Concept
Client intro → the problem → the shift explained → results timeline
Why It Works
Specific numbers + specific mechanism. Viewers see themselves in the before state.
"The biggest lie in the coaching industry (I used to believe it too)"
Angle
Industry criticism builds anti-guru credibility
Shot Concept
The common claim → why it is wrong → what actually works → proof
Why It Works
Anti-guru positioning is rare and refreshing. Creates strong follower loyalty.
"If you're stuck at [specific revenue/stage], do this one thing"
Angle
Hyper-specific targeting for ideal clients
Shot Concept
Name the stage → diagnose the bottleneck → prescribe one action → expected outcome
Why It Works
Specificity makes viewers feel "this is for me." Drives DMs from ideal clients.
"What my morning routine actually looks like as a coach making $XXK/month"
Angle
Lifestyle peek with credibility anchor
Shot Concept
Morning sequence → work setup → client calls → income context without bragging
Why It Works
Aspiration + attainability. Shows the lifestyle while keeping it grounded.

Can coaches really get high-ticket clients from TikTok?▼
Yes — the path is: TikTok content → follow → DM conversation → discovery call. Coaches report that TikTok leads are warmer than cold outreach because viewers have already consumed hours of free content before reaching out.
What kind of coaching content performs best on TikTok?▼
Specific, actionable advice outperforms motivational content. Content that names a specific problem at a specific stage and gives a specific solution attracts ideal clients. Generic inspiration attracts followers but not buyers.
How do I avoid looking "salesy" as a coach on TikTok?▼
Lead with value, not offers. Give your best advice for free. The 80/20 rule: 80% pure value content, 20% client results and soft CTAs. Never hard-sell in the content — let DMs and comments drive the sales conversation.
